The formula combines several key ingredients. Talc provides the silky texture. Silica helps absorb oil and control shine. Boron Nitride creates a smooth, velvety finish. Dimethicone adds a creamy quality that helps the powder blend seamlessly. The glass beads deliver the signature radiance.

How to Apply Rodial Glass Powder Correctly
Proper application technique makes all the difference when using the Rodial Glass Powder. Follow these steps for the best results.
Start with clean, moisturized skin and your regular base makeup. You can apply this powder over foundation, BB cream, or even bare skin. Make sure your base products are fully set before reaching for the powder.
Choose the right tool for your desired effect. A large, fluffy powder brush works beautifully for all over application. This gives a light, diffused finish. For more precise placement and heavier coverage, use a smaller, denser brush. You can also use a powder puff for traditional baking techniques.
Pour a small amount of powder into the jar lid. This prevents contamination of the full product. Swirl your brush in the powder, then tap off any excess. This prevents over application and ensures a natural finish.
Apply the powder using gentle pressing or rolling motions. Do not drag the brush across your skin. Focus on areas that tend to get oily first. The T zone typically needs the most attention. Press the powder into these areas to ensure it stays in place.
For the rest of your face, use a lighter hand. Dust the powder gently across your cheeks, forehead, and chin. You want a subtle veil of coverage, not a heavy layer. The goal is to enhance your skin, not cover it completely.
Pay special attention to under your eyes if you have set concealer. Use a small brush or beauty sponge to gently press powder into this delicate area. This prevents creasing and helps your concealer last longer.
Finish by misting your face with a setting spray if desired. This helps meld all your makeup layers together and extends wear time even further.

Comparing Rodial Glass Powder with Other Popular Setting Powders
How does the Rodial Glass Powder stack up against other luxury setting powders on the market?
Versus Hourglass Ambient Lighting Powder: The Hourglass powder uses photoluminescent technology for a similar soft focus effect. Both products blur imperfections beautifully. The main difference lies in the finish.
Hourglass powders tend to be more pigmented and come in various shades. The Rodial powder is translucent and focuses more on the glass skin effect. Hourglass works better as a finishing powder over set makeup. Rodial excels as both a setting and finishing powder.
Versus Laura Mercier Translucent Powder: Laura Mercier is the gold standard for traditional setting powder. It sets makeup flawlessly and controls oil effectively. However, it creates a more matte finish.
The Rodial powder maintains more luminosity and radiance. Laura Mercier works better for extremely oily skin or when you want a completely matte look. Rodial is superior when you want that glowing, glass skin appearance.

How does Rodial Glass Powder compare to the pressed version?
Rodial offers both loose and pressed versions of the Glass Powder. The loose version provides a more diffused, natural finish. It applies very lightly and builds gradually. The pressed version offers more coverage and portability. It travels better since it cannot spill. The pressed formula works well for touch ups throughout the day.
